George aged 19 is a delight to be around. He loves to be kept active – whether it be people watching in Costa Coffee or even going shopping to add to his shoe collection. Yes, George’s parents describe him as little bit of a shopaholic! George has cerebral palsy and epilepsy. He is wheelchair dependent and is non-verbal, he communicates using eye pointing and 'yes' and 'no' hand gestures. All nutrition and medication are administered via PEG. It is key that you spend time with him and really get to know the person he is and to fully understand his likes, dislikes, emotions and hobbies etc.

The role includes planning activities, trips and days out, whilst providing the best care to ensure George is safe, healthy and of course happy! You will assist with his personal care, medication, feeding, physiotherapy and keeping areas he uses clean and tidy. He will need your assistance for all his activities so you'll need to be creative and patient. This role is 2:1 care, working alongside members of the existing care team and family members.

This position would suit someone who is very hands on, who is not afraid to get ‘stuck in’ with activities whilst having a fun, pro-active and with a flexible approach. Previous experience working with teenagers with cerebral palsy is essential, as well as having the confidence to administer George’s medication, as this is an intricate part of the care.
